Plumbing costs change based on the complexity of the repair and the accessibility of the pipes. If a pro needs to cut into drywall or dig underground to reach a leak, the labor time increases. Older homes sometimes require updating outdated materials, like galvanized steel, to meet current codes. The timing of the service also matters, as after-hours or holiday calls often carry different rates than standard business hours. While simple drain clearings or fixture swaps are usually on the lower end, larger system repipes cost more.

Before calling a plumber for a plumbing pipe leak in Elgin, locate and shut off your main water supply valve to minimize water damage. If the leak is near an electrical outlet or appliance, ensure the power is safely disconnected. Document the location and apparent severity of the leak. Having this information ready will help the professional diagnose the problem more efficiently once they arrive to assess the situation.
